Cracking the Code: .kar vs. .cdg Files

Next, we need to decipher the mysterious world of karaoke files. You’ve probably seen the extensions .kar and .cdg floating around. These aren’t just random letters; they’re the containers that hold the audio and lyrical data that makes karaoke, well, karaoke. Think of them as the sheet music for your rockstar dreams.

.Kar files are essentially MIDI files with lyrics embedded. They’re relatively simple and, handily, often directly editable with basic text editors. .Cdg files, on the other hand, are more complex. They usually come paired with an MP3 or other audio file and display lyrics as graphics. The magic happens when the .cdg file tells the player when to display which lyric, perfectly in sync with the music. While .cdg files are more common, especially for commercially produced karaoke tracks, knowing the difference can be a lifesaver when you’re trying to tweak a song. These files contain the secrets to how the words appear, when they appear, and for how long!

Utilizing a Second Display for Optimal Viewing

Imagine trying to read a map while driving using only your rearview mirror—totally chaotic, right? Similarly, relying solely on the KaraFun interface for lyrics while performing can be a bit of a distraction. That’s where the second display comes in. Think of it as your karaoke lifeline—a dedicated screen showcasing your hard-earned lyrical changes.

A second monitor, a TV, or even a projector pointed at the wall can work wonders! Hooking it up is usually as simple as connecting the display to your computer’s video output (HDMI, VGA, DisplayPort, etc.) and then diving into your computer’s display settings. On Windows, you’re looking for the “Extend” display option (right-click on the desktop, select “Display settings,” and then choose “Extend these displays”). On a Mac, head to “System Preferences,” then “Displays,” and finally “Arrangement” to mirror or extend your display.

The goal is to make the second screen a lyric-only zone. This keeps distractions minimal and lets you fully immerse yourself in the performance, becoming the karaoke rockstar you were always meant to be!

Public Performance: Staying Within the Boundaries

So, you’ve tweaked some lyrics and you’re ready to unleash your inner rock star at the local karaoke bar? Awesome! But hold on a sec… there’s another layer to this copyright cake. Performing copyrighted songs – even with your super-clever modifications – in a public setting like a bar or a restaurant requires a bit more consideration. Think of it like throwing a party in a rented space – you might need a permit!

Essentially, when you perform a song publicly, you’re giving a “public performance,” and that’s where performing rights organizations (PROs) like ASCAP, BMI, and SESAC come in. These organizations represent songwriters and publishers, and they collect royalties for public performances of their songs. The venues that host karaoke nights typically obtain blanket licenses from these PROs, allowing them to legally host performances of a vast catalog of songs.

However, it’s still a good idea to be aware of the rules. If you’re planning to perform your modified lyrics in public, it’s best to err on the side of caution.

Here are a few tips to stay within the legal and ethical lines:

  • Keep it Personal: Stick to modifying lyrics for your own private use and enjoyment.
  • Don’t Distribute Without Permission: Resist the urge to share your lyric creations online or with others without obtaining the necessary permissions.
  • License Up for Public Performance: If you’re planning to perform your modified lyrics publicly, make sure the venue has the appropriate licenses or consider obtaining your own.

How does KaraFun handle the synchronization of lyrics with the music?

KaraFun synchronizes lyrics with music using a time-based system. The software associates each word or phrase with a specific timestamp, indicating when it should appear during the song. When a user plays a karaoke track, KaraFun reads these timestamps. Based on these timestamps, it displays the lyrics in sync with the music.
